Used to visit this restaurant some years ago when still on Alter St. We loved the food, oh my!! Delicious! Dimitri could see us from the little kitchen and immediately knew my husband wanted Chile rellenos! It was always wonderful!! I’d usually get the ribeye steak with sautéed onions, melted cheese, etc. Always delicious as well. Very sweet family and children. We moved to California a few years or so, then back to PA. Tonight was our first trip to the restaurant at its “new” location. Totally different experience!!! We could barely understand our waiter he barely spoke and almost a whisper! We both had the ribeye dinners. On mine the ribeye was over cooked and chewy, onions way undercooked, and no melted cheese, only a slice of cold cheese sitting next to the steak! Yuck! I asked the waiter when he finally checked on us if they could melt the cheese on the steak and he just looked at me and said Ohh I don’t know…. and just stood there saying nothing then walked away! So I only ate s few bites of that entire meal. No thanks. Not worth eating. SO different from Alter Street days!!! What a shame. Sorry Dimitri! We still love you but not the food or the staff or the new location! Hope it goes better for others than it was...

Food was made by someone who wants to enjoy life while eating. Can hands down say, if not one of the best, possibly THE best Mexican restaurant we’ve ever been to. Delicious doesn’t really cover how good the food was. Portions are great. Food came out fast. Presentation was really good too! Our server was was so sweet and attentive. Restaurant is spacious, well laid out and very clean. Bathroom is lovely! I was surprised when I walked in, like taken aback by how much time and thought they put into the bathroom. Very clean. Loved it! Too bad we were just passing through. Suuuuuuper duuuuuuper recommend! :) Husbands quesadillas are super recommend worthy, he usually feel yucky and inflamed after most restaurant food, but he made the point to mention that he felt really good after eating that meal. He exclaimedly expressed his appreciation for the flavor of his dish.

I had the big burrito and the green salsa especially made a wonderful combination with the tasty steak inside.

My daughter’s children’s plate was hefty and she scarfed it down. Thumbs up for that! The server was especially sweet to our daughter. Thanks for that.

Thank you El Mariachi and staff,...

My family was traveling and we’re excited to find a Mexican restaurant with good reviews. We were thinking it was a great choice when we arrived to find it was in an old church. However it went downhill from there. We asked about cheese dip (white Mexican cheese dip) and the waitress seemed stunned. We always get cheese dip for chips when we get Mexican. We never received the dip and after reading the menu learned they only had nacho cheese. For my family of 6 we were given two small baskets of chips which my 6 year old devoured quickly. When my wife asked for more chips were we’re told the baskets were $2 each. I’ve never seen a Mexican restaurant where I had to pay for extra chips. The menu was difficult to read and written mainly in Spanish. We finally located And ordered quesadillas for our family and plain for our kids. My kids like their food plain. (Chicken and cheese)and we made it clear to the waitress. When the food arrived about 30 minutes later the quesadillas were covered in sour cream. I’ve never waited more than 10-15 minutes for food at any of our local Mexican restaurants. Our family was very disappointed with...

We ordered Enchiladas, 4 tacos ( Canitas, Carne Asada, chorizo, and Spicy Pork) with rice and beans. The best was the chorizo taco, spicy pork taco, Enchiladas and the rice. I would go back and get any of those. For the worst the carnitas where dry, Carne asada had no flavor, and the beans had zero seasoning like they just got boiled out of the can and where served. I was disappointed because at 1st glance the rice and beans look delicious but then when you eat the beans it ruins the whole meal being satisfying. If I could suggest anything I would say marinate the Asada better, season your beans or add meat to them, and have the staff look more professional with matching uniform or t shirts.

A random Google search for Mexican restaurants in Hazelton and we found a gem. The waitress made it seem as if they had no veggies for a vegetarian enchilada but she went back and checked with the chef, they could make it. I didn't have high hopes of anything spectacular but was I wrong. It was the most gourmet vegetarian enchilada ever. Peppers, fresh diced tomatoes, cauliflower and broccoli. I loved it! Plus the rice and beans were a perfect side as well as the chips and salsa served when you sit down.

The food here is excellent. It is not "Americanized Mexican." I took my father here and he told me the food here was more like he actually ate in Mexico. Two downsides. First the credit card machine was broken. It was necessary to find an ATM and get cash. Second, the decor doesn't really seem Mexican. El Mariachi moved here just after or during COVID-19. If I had to guess, I would say it was previously an Italian restaurant. Mexican accents have been added, but Corinthian columns aren't really Mexican.
